Our inaugural Vintage of our Sparkling Wine!
 
 
The traditional-method Brut is made from Riesling, Gruner Veltliner and Cabernet Franc, a unique combination of varietals that all grow on our site. After hand-picking into baskets, carefully sorting and loading into the press, the wine was fermented and aged in two neutral french oak barriques, left to mature on the lees for 5 months, then settled in tank before being bottled with the yeast to complete the secondary fermentation--which gives it added yeasty flavours and the bubbles that we love. We had a local company riddle (moving the bottles until the yeast settles in the neck) and then disgorge the wine in the summer, separating the yeast from the clean wine in the bottle and adding a final dose of prepared wine for sweetness. The resulting sparkling wine is toasty, fresh and citrusy on the nose and smooth on the palate, finishing with a ripe peach/green strawberry note from the Cabernet Franc element. Like the Axiom red blend that we make, the Archive will appear in specific vintages where the conditions and crop level guarantee quality. Serve chilled!

Wine Profile
Tasting Notes
- Bright white-gold with yellow-green highlights, fine mousse and medium persistence - Nose features bright lemon and tangerine, white floral notes baked apple and pear tart, lightly toasted marshmallow. Fragrant and fruity with the lees influence adding depth. - Palate has full mousse with fine bubbles, and is dry, rich in texture with balanced acidity. Ripe and fruity with a lingering finish of white orchard fruit, good length.
Production Notes
- 100% from Intersection handpicked into small baskets on September 15, 2021 - Whole bunch pressed to stainless tank, fermented in neutral French oak barrels 2 weeks at cellar temps, then aged on lees 5 months with batonnage for the first 3 months. - Tirage bottled by hand at Intersection using encapsulated yeast - Riddled and disgorged offsite for finished packaging
